How they compare

Micronesia (Federated States of) currently reports 55.51 % against 43.94 % in Timor-Leste, a difference of 11.57 %.

That makes Micronesia (Federated States of)'s figure about 1.3 times Timor-Leste's.

Across all 34 years both countries report, Micronesia (Federated States of) has been ahead every year.

Micronesia (Federated States of) ranks 10th and Timor-Leste ranks 12th of 21 countries.

Micronesia (Federated States of) has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Micronesia (Federated States of) Timor-Leste Difference Ahead
1990s 50.89 % 44.45 % 6.44 % Micronesia (Federated States of)
2000s 51.34 % 44.78 % 6.56 % Micronesia (Federated States of)
2010s 54.39 % 44.09 % 10.3 % Micronesia (Federated States of)
2020s 55.54 % 43.94 % 11.6 % Micronesia (Federated States of)

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The FAOSTAT Land Use domain contains data on twenty-one land use categories and twenty-three categories of irrigation and agricultural practices. Data are available yearly and by country, regional and global levels. The domain includes Land Use Indicators providing information on the percentage share of agricultural and forest land, and their sub-components, including irrigated areas and areas under organic agriculture, within a country land use matrix. Data are available at country, regional and global level, for the following elements: (in percentage) i) Share in Land area; ii) Share in Agricultural land, iii) Share in Cropland; and iv) Share in Forest land; (in ha/pc) v) Area per capita.
